Hazardous Materials Technicians are trained to respond to hazardous materials emergencies in an offensive fashion. Their primary role is to stop or control a spill or release by approaching the point of the release using specialized personal protective equipment (PPE). Hazmat Technicians are typically members of Hazmat Teams, often referred to as Spill Response Teams or Emergency Response Teams, when they respond to chemical spills. OSHA requires Hazardous Materials Technicians to be trained in accordance with section (q) of the HAZWOPER regulation 29 CFR 1910.120. This training is also referred to as Hazmat Tech, Level III Responder, Industry Tech, or any combination of these terms. Per OSHA, this training requires annual refresher training of sufficient content and duration to maintain responder competencies.
